How Michigan’s Climate Impacts Ventilation

Michigan’s climate plays a crucial role in determining the effectiveness of roof ventilation systems. During the winter months, cold outdoor temperatures can lead to inadequate airflow, increasing the risk of moisture issues, such as ice dams and mold growth. In contrast, warmer months can cause heat buildup in the attic, necessitating effective attic ventilation to maintain optimal indoor conditions. Understanding how seasonal changes affect moisture levels and airflow is vital to ensuring both the longevity of your roofing system and your home’s energy efficiency.

Common Roof Ventilation Myths

Many common beliefs about roof ventilation are myths. These misconceptions often lead Portage, MI homeowners to make decisions that harm energy efficiency, air quality, and structural integrity. Knowing the facts is key to a healthier home.

Falling for these myths can result in costly errors, like installing the wrong number of vents or missing signs of poor ventilation. Let’s debunk frequent misunderstandings so you can make smart choices and avoid unnecessary repairs.

More Roof Vents Always Mean Better Results

The belief that increasing the number of roof vents directly translates to enhanced ventilation is a common misconception. Excessive ventilation can disrupt the balance needed for effective attic ventilation, leading to inefficient airflow. A properly designed roof system considers the square foot of ventilation needed based on the home’s dimensions and climate, rather than simply maximizing vents. This misjudgment may result in insufficient airflow, causing moisture problems and potential structural damage, both of which can incur costly repairs for homeowners.

Proper Ventilation Is Only Needed for Large Homes

Proper ventilation is crucial regardless of home size. Smaller homes often face just as many risks related to moisture problems and poor air quality. Insufficient ventilation can lead to heat buildup in the attic, inviting issues like mold growth and wood rot. Each roofing system requires a specific amount of ventilation to maintain energy efficiency and protect the structural integrity of the roof. Homeowners should prioritize proper attic ventilation to prevent costly repairs, irrespective of their living space dimensions.

The Risks of Over-Ventilating Your Roof

Over-ventilating a roof can have unintended consequences that compromise your home’s structural integrity and energy efficiency. Excessive ventilation may lead to imbalances in airflow, causing moisture levels to escalate and resulting in costly repairs from water damage, mold growth, or wood rot. In colder climates like Portage, MI, improper attic ventilation can also contribute to ice dams and heat buildup. Ensuring the right balance of exhaust vents and adequate attic insulation is crucial for maintaining a healthy roofing system.

Potential Moisture Problems and Winter Issues

In colder months, inadequate roof ventilation can lead to significant moisture problems, including ice dams and mold growth. Warm air rising into the attic space can trap moisture, creating an environment ripe for water damage and structural issues. Insufficient ventilation exacerbates this, allowing moist air to linger and condense on colder surfaces, leading to costly repairs. Maintaining proper airflow with the right balance of exhaust vents helps mitigate these risks, ensuring your roofing system remains functional throughout the seasons.

Why Too Many Vents Can Affect Roof Performance

An overabundance of vents can lead to improper airflow, ultimately diminishing your roofing system’s efficiency. Excessive ventilation may disrupt air pressure balance, causing heat buildup and allowing warm, moist air to linger longer than necessary. This imbalance can lead to increased energy costs and moisture issues, including mold growth or wood rot. In colder months, the risk of ice dams rises as heat escapes unevenly. Balancing the number of vents ensures effective attic ventilation, enhancing your home’s energy efficiency.

Frequently Asked Questions

What is the 1 to 300 rule for ventilation?

The 1 to 300 rule is a general guideline for the minimum amount of ventilation needed. It suggests one square foot of ventilation for every 300 square feet of attic floor space. This total area should be split evenly between intake and exhaust for proper attic ventilation.

Do I need rafter vents in every rafter?

Rafter vents, or baffles, are crucial for proper attic ventilation. They create a channel for proper airflow between your attic insulation and the roof deck. You should install them in each rafter bay above an intake vent to prevent insulation from blocking the airflow from your soffits.
